What they're asking for

In the registry's own words. Descriptions are only filed for meetings since mid-2024.

  1. Pursue dedicated federal funding from Canadian Heritage and Infrastructure Canada to expand CPRA's Canadian Parks, Recreation and Sport Infrastructure Database to help municipalities and local organizations enhance planning efforts, identify opportunities to maximize facility usage, and benchmark provision standards.

    November 25, 2025 · Rebecca Alty · Liberal · Employment and Training; Health; Immigration; Infrastructure; Labour

  2. Positioning CPRA as a delivery partner in the Government of Canada's workforce strategy, with a focus on expanding access to youth employment through the Youth Employment and Skills Strategy (YESS). CPRA seeks federal investment to grow sector capacity, address labour shortages, and create meaningful youth employment opportunities that improve public health, promote inclusion, and reduce risk factors such as justice system involvement.

    October 20, 2025 · Maggie Chi · Liberal · Employment and Training; Health; Infrastructure; Labour; Regional Development
